在现代企业网络和远程办公环境中,VPN(虚拟私人网络)已成为保障数据安全传输的重要工具,当用户报告“VPN服务器未反应”时,这不仅影响工作效率,还可能暴露网络安全风险,作为网络工程师,面对此类问题必须迅速定位故障根源,确保服务尽快恢复,本文将从多个维度系统分析常见原因,并提供实用的排查步骤和解决方案。
我们需要明确“未反应”的具体表现:是无法连接到VPN服务器?还是连接后无响应?或者是登录失败?不同现象对应不同的排查方向,假设用户反馈的是“无法建立连接”,我们可以按以下逻辑逐层检查:
第一步:确认本地网络状态。
即使服务器正常,如果客户端所在网络存在阻断或延迟过高,也可能导致连接失败,使用ping命令测试到目标IP地址的连通性(如ping 192.168.10.1),若超时或丢包严重,则说明本地网络存在问题,此时应检查路由器、防火墙规则是否误封了UDP 500/4500端口(IPSec常用端口)或TCP 443端口(OpenVPN常用端口),建议使用Wireshark抓包分析是否有请求被拦截。
第二步:验证VPN服务器自身状态。
登录服务器主机,检查关键服务是否运行,在Linux环境下执行systemctl status strongswan或systemctl status openvpn,查看服务是否处于active状态,用netstat -tulnp | grep :500等命令确认监听端口是否存在,若服务未启动,可能是配置文件错误或资源不足(如内存耗尽),此时需查看日志文件(如/var/log/syslog或journalctl -u openvpn.service)获取详细报错信息。
第三步:检查防火墙与安全组策略。
很多情况下,服务器虽已启动服务,但因防火墙规则未开放相应端口而无法访问,在云环境中(如阿里云、AWS),需确认安全组是否允许来自公网的特定端口入站流量,本地物理服务器则需检查iptables或firewalld规则,若使用IKEv2协议,必须开放UDP 500和4500端口;若为PPTP,则需开启TCP 1723及GRE协议(通常不推荐使用,因其安全性较低)。
第四步:测试DNS解析与证书有效性。
部分VPN服务依赖域名而非IP地址,若DNS解析异常(如返回错误IP或超时),也会导致连接失败,可使用nslookup或dig命令测试域名解析是否正常,SSL/TLS证书过期或自签名证书未被客户端信任,也可能中断连接,建议在客户端手动导入服务器证书,并确保证书链完整。
第五步:考虑负载与并发限制。
高并发场景下,若服务器未配置合理的最大连接数限制(如OpenVPN的max-clients参数),可能导致新连接被拒绝,可通过监控工具(如htop、nethogs)观察CPU、内存使用率,判断是否存在资源瓶颈。
若上述步骤均未解决问题,建议联系ISP或云服务商,确认是否存在DDoS防护误判或线路中断,备份当前配置并尝试重启服务,有时简单重启能解决临时性异常。
“VPN服务器未反应”是一个典型但复杂的网络问题,需要结合本地、服务端、安全策略等多方面因素综合判断,掌握以上排查流程,不仅能快速恢复服务,更能提升网络运维的专业能力,每一次故障都是优化网络架构的契机。

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速






